In recent years, Northeast Atlanta has emerged as a highly desirable area, attracting both families and professionals due to its excellent schools, burgeoning job market, and a plethora of recreational activities. Neighborhoods such as Brookhaven, Decatur, and Peachtree Corners offer a wide range of housing options, from charming historic homes to modern condominiums, catering to diverse preferences and budgets.

For Buyers: As potential homebuyers navigate Northeast Atlanta's market, it's crucial to focus on several key aspects. First, understanding property values in various neighborhoods will help you make an informed decision. Conduct thorough research on recent sales, analyze trends, and consider future developments that could influence property appreciation. Furthermore, securing pre-approval for a mortgage before starting your house hunt can give you a competitive edge. It demonstrates your seriousness to sellers and can streamline the purchasing process once you find your dream home.

For Sellers: Those looking to sell in Northeast Atlanta should focus on strategies that enhance their property's marketability. Start by investing in essential repairs and updates that increase curb appeal. In this digital age, high-quality photos and virtual tours are vital in capturing prospective buyers' attention online.

Pricing your home correctly is perhaps the most crucial decision. Overpricing can deter potential buyers, while underpricing might not reflect your home's true value. Consulting with a local real estate professional who understands Northeast Atlanta's market nuances can help you set an optimal asking price.
